Abstract

The rotating-piston engine has a ring-shaped cylinder (1), extending over somewhat more than 180 deg. This is rectangular in section and has a central slot in its inside wall. Side-by-side in this slot are two discs mounted on separate shafts, one solid, one hollow and both concentric with the cylinder. Each disc periphery carries two pistons (7, 8; 9.10), diametrically opposed and running in the cylinder. All moving parts rotate in the same direction (11). Fluid enters the spaces between adjacent pistons in the intake zone (12) to be discharged later in the cycle (13); there is a timing device to regulate the relative movement of the piston pairs to promote this.
